Author of novels such as Our Lady of Flowers and Querelle de Brest, Jean Genet (1911–1986) was a cursed author and activist. A declared homosexual at a time when sexual orientations were hidden, Genet began writing his novels, poetry and plays in prison at the age of 32 and became one of the most productive and controversial French writers of the 20th century. Bringing together records, archival research and his own material, Argentine director Miguel Zeballos draws a parallel between the legacy of Genet's art and activism with today’s struggles.

Miguel Zeballos

Born in 1976 in Neuquén, Argentina, is a director and writer. His first features were El Desembarco (2011) and Un Recuerdo Borrándose Muestra Sus Últimos Destellos (2013), both exhibited in festivals no Peru, Uruguay, Columbia and Argentina. He also directed Un continente incendiándose (2018), Retiros (in)voluntarios (2020) and Esplendor de los Días Venideros (2022)
